I'm an amputee, had my leg off in September, had 5 sockets made since then and one of the times they forgot to put in the hardener. When I was down a month ago I was told it would be one or two weeks for the prosthetic to be made, its been a month, I'm disgusted, I don't know where to turn next. I'm so so frustrated and so so down.
The physio has been great but prosthetic has been such a let down. I've done everything the physio has asked, got super fit, but the sockets they have made have been inadequate and fallen off. They've made loads of excuses, its just the shape of my leg. It feels like they are trying to pan me off onto a wheelchair,
My OT physio got me into the local gym to try and get me back into the right headspace, I just want to mentally get back up and move with my life- the prosthetics department just build my hopes all up and then hit me with 'problems in the workshop'. Well thats not my problem as a patient, at the end of the day, I've had my leg off since September, it is not unreasonable to expect to have had some help by now.
It just seems like an absolute disaster, seems to be far far too many patients for the staff, even in the Gym. I feel they don't spend any time with you, tell you to do something and then walk away and you just have to figure our what to do yourself, just not enough staff.
I've even tried to go private, but no one wants to touch an NHS patient, just say, we don't do that here. Feel like I'm in limbo
